Definition

Australian adoption of ISO 10218 via AS 4024.3301 mandates rigorous safety verification, leading to high costs from iterative testing and consultant fees for robot safety certification.

Key Findings

  • Financial Impact: AUD 15,000 - 50,000 per robot model in testing fees; 200-400 engineer hours per certification
  • Frequency: Per new robot model or system upgrade
  • Root Cause: Complexity of PL/SIL calculations under AS 4024 and IEC 62061
